教你怎么解決IDEA中“\t“空格顯示不正確的問題
一、問題描述:
在Java開發(fā)的過程中"\t"的作用為補(bǔ)全當(dāng)前字符串長度到8的整數(shù)倍,最少1個最多8個空格,具體要補(bǔ)多少個空格要看"\t"之前字符串長度。例如:
1、當(dāng)前字符串長度10,那么\t后長度是16,也就是補(bǔ)6個空格。
2、如果當(dāng)前字符串長度12,此時\t后長度是16,補(bǔ)4個空格。
當(dāng)前遇到的問題為"\t"補(bǔ)全的長度不是8的整數(shù)倍,甚至還出現(xiàn)了補(bǔ)全的長度各不相同的情況
二、原因分析:
重新運(yùn)行代碼、重啟電腦好幾次都是輸出這樣的結(jié)果,由此推斷可能是IDEA軟件本身的問題,把相同的代碼復(fù)制到了eclipse中運(yùn)行就可以補(bǔ)全到字符串長度為8的整數(shù)倍,因此確定了可能是IDEA本身設(shè)置的問題,所以看了IDEA的使用文檔后才發(fā)現(xiàn),沒有手動設(shè)置過縮進(jìn)的IDEA自動補(bǔ)齊的位數(shù)不是8位,因此要想讓IDEA中"\t"補(bǔ)齊到8位就需要單獨(dú)設(shè)置。
三、解決方案:
到此這篇關(guān)于教你怎么解決IDEA中“\t“空格顯示不正確的問題的文章就介紹到這了,更多相關(guān)IDEA中“\t“空格顯示不正確內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
- IDEA中設(shè)置Tab健為4個空格的方法
- JAVA IDEA入門使用手冊(新手小白必備)
- IDEA必備開發(fā)神器之EasyCode
- Java黑科技之通過Google Java Style 文件配置IDEA和Ecplise代碼風(fēng)格
- 教你怎么用idea創(chuàng)建web項目
- 教你怎么通過IDEA設(shè)置堆內(nèi)存空間
- 教你怎么用Idea打包jar包
- IDEA快速搭建jsp項目的圖文教程
- idea導(dǎo)入項目框架的詳細(xì)操作方法
- IDEA2019.3配置Hibernate的詳細(xì)教程(未使用IDEA的自動化)
- 通過idea打包項目到docker的操作方法
- 關(guān)于IDEA配置Hibernate中遇到的問題解決
相關(guān)文章
基于Springboot實現(xiàn)JWT認(rèn)證的示例代碼
本文主要介紹了基于Springboot實現(xiàn)JWT認(rèn)證,文中通過示例代碼介紹的非常詳細(xì),具有一定的參考價值,感興趣的小伙伴們可以參考一下2021-11-11解決沒有@RunWith 和 @SpringBootTest注解或失效問題
這篇文章主要介紹了解決沒有@RunWith 和 @SpringBootTest注解或失效問題,具有很好的參考價值,希望對大家有所幫助。一起跟隨小編過來看看吧2020-04-04Java transient 關(guān)鍵字詳解及實例代碼
本文章向大家介紹Java transient關(guān)鍵字的使用方法和實例,包括的知識點(diǎn)有transient的作用、transient使用小結(jié)、transient使用細(xì)節(jié),需要的朋友可以參考一下2016-12-12Java字符串格式化功能?String.format用法詳解
String類的format()方法用于創(chuàng)建格式化的字符串以及連接多個字符串對象,熟悉C語言的同學(xué)應(yīng)該記得C語言的sprintf()方法,兩者有類似之處,format()方法有兩種重載形式2024-09-09Java實現(xiàn)在Word中嵌入多媒體(視頻、音頻)文件
這篇文章主要介紹了Java如何實現(xiàn)在Word中嵌入多媒體(視頻、音頻)文件,文中的示例代碼講解詳細(xì),對我們學(xué)習(xí)java有一定的幫助,感興趣的同學(xué)可以了解一下2021-12-12